The Boeing Company’s Airport Operations Engineering (AOE) group is seeking an Experienced Airport Engineer to join their team in Rzeszow, Poland.
The successful candidate will contribute to our high visibility work statement to assure that Boeing airplanes are compatible with and have access to the airports around the world, strive for airport regulations that are equitable and achievable for Boeing aircraft. Will ensure that new airplane design requirements result in minimal aircraft/airport constraints, minimize airport limitations/restrictions on our aircraft and provide airplane programs support.
Position Responsibilities:
- Provides expertise in aircraft/airport compatibility issues to include airport operations & planning, and pavement analysis (roughness & strength).
- Compares airplane configurations with airport operations and infrastructure to identify incompatible airplane or airport features.
- Surveys, analyzes, and documents airport infrastructure and provides recommendations for improvements including developing operational plans.
- Conducts trade studies of product development airplane design characteristics and provides recommendations on configuration changes to improve airport compatibility.
- Participates in airport-related conferences, regulatory and industry meetings to disseminate airplane product trends and effect regulatory and airport infrastructure changes to improve compatibility with Boeing aircraft.
- Applies knowledge of airfield pavement design and evaluation using latest FAA software to perform structural analysis of pavement.
- Experience in conducting onsite airfield roughness testing and evaluation, as well as pavement strength testing.
- Recommends changes to facilities and/or procedures to support removal of operational restrictions.
- Coordinates release of airport or airplane information as requested.
- Applies knowledge of military and commercially available aeronautical data to conduct analyses.
- Mentors and trains early career engineers.
- Advises management in process improvement and implementation.
- Oversees quality control, maintaining quality standards in all work produced by checking computations and drawings performed by others.
- Analyzes technical problems and provides new approaches and alternative solutions.
